A Multisite Molecular Salt Enables Surface Passivation and Energetics Management for Efficient Inverted Perovskite Solar Cells

Se ha desarrollado una estrategia de modificación superficial mediante una capa molecular multifuncional (sal sódica SCP) que reduce los defectos superficiales y mejora la alineación energética en células solares de perovskita invertidas. Los investigadores demostraron que esta pasivación coordinativa de Pb²⁺ no solo suprime la recombinación asistida por trampas y la actividad iónica interfacial, sino que también reconstruye la estructura electrónica superficial, logrando una eficiencia certificada del 26.84% en estado estacionario.
